    Understanding eCommerce SEO

    eCommerce SEO involves optimizing your online store’s pages to appear prominently in search engine results pages (SERPs) when potential customers search for relevant products or services. Unlike traditional SEO, eCommerce SEO focuses on product pages, categories, and specific transactional keywords that lead directly to conversions.

    Key Tactics for eCommerce SEO Success

    1. Keyword Research and Optimization
      Conduct thorough keyword research to identify high-intent keywords relevant to your products. Tools like Google Keyword Planner, SEMrush, and Ahrefs can help uncover valuable keyword opportunities. Integrate these keywords naturally into your product titles, descriptions, and meta tags to improve visibility.
      Example: When optimizing your eCommerce SEO strategy, prioritize long-tail keywords that reflect user intent, such as “affordable men’s running shoes” or “organic baby clothes online.”
    2. Optimized Product Descriptions and Content
      Craft compelling product descriptions that not only describe features but also address customer pain points and benefits. Use bullet points, reviews, and user-generated content to enhance engagement and provide valuable information.
      Example: Incorporate eCommerce SEO techniques by including relevant keywords strategically throughout your product descriptions and ensuring readability and coherence.
    3. Technical SEO Enhancements
      Ensure your eCommerce site is technically optimized for search engines. Focus on improving site speed, mobile responsiveness, and implementing structured data markup (Schema.org) to enhance SERP visibility and user experience.
      Example: Enhance your eCommerce SEO efforts by regularly auditing and optimizing your site’s structure, URL structure, and internal linking to improve crawlability and indexation.
    4. Link Building and Authority Building
      Build authoritative backlinks from reputable sites within your industry to boost your eCommerce site’s authority and credibility. Engage in guest blogging, influencer collaborations, and strategic partnerships to acquire quality backlinks.
      Example: Develop a robust eCommerce SEO strategy by actively pursuing backlinks from relevant sources and leveraging social proof to increase domain authority.

    Tools for eCommerce SEO Success

    • Google Search Console: Monitor your site’s performance, identify indexing issues, and optimize your eCommerce SEO strategy based on real-time data.
    • Yoast SEO Plugin (for WordPress): Streamline on-page SEO optimization, including meta tags, XML sitemaps, and content readability analysis.
    • SEMrush: Conduct comprehensive keyword research, track keyword rankings, and analyze competitors’ SEO strategies to refine your approach.
    • Ahrefs: Explore backlink opportunities, analyze competitor backlink profiles, and monitor your eCommerce site’s link-building progress.
